|
|
@46865542
|
12/07/19 11:06:01 |
Sebastian Huber |
rtems: Simplify semaphore configuration
The MrsP semaphore …
5
|
|
|
@d0b704b0
|
12/05/19 06:08:52 |
Sebastian Huber |
libtest: Change expected pass state string
Use separator character …
5
|
|
|
@9f3c558
|
11/05/19 05:32:03 |
Sebastian Huber |
tests: Remove superfluous SMPTESTS define
Update #3818.
5
|
|
|
@5fa893e
|
05/20/19 07:15:36 |
Sebastian Huber |
score: Add _SMP_Unicast_action()
5
|
|
|
@577293f0
|
04/28/19 12:31:10 |
Sebastian Huber |
score: Add _SMP_Synchronize()
5
|
|
|
@fe24820e
|
04/27/19 10:39:25 |
Sebastian Huber |
smpipi01: Use per-CPU jobs for IPI flood test
5
|
|
|
@21e691b
|
04/28/19 12:43:19 |
Sebastian Huber |
smpipi01: Ensure IPI works on all processors
5
|
|
|
@7cb881f
|
04/19/19 12:34:50 |
Sebastian Huber |
smpipi01: Use per-CPU jobs for pending IPI test
5
|
|
|
@c63e8bb
|
04/19/19 09:02:02 |
Sebastian Huber |
score: Modify _Per_CPU_Perform_jobs()
Process only the jobs initially …
5
|
|
|
@85d6e845
|
04/19/19 09:01:31 |
Sebastian Huber |
score: Add _Per_CPU_Add_job()
5
|
|
|
@3b2481f
|
04/18/19 05:08:32 |
Sebastian Huber |
score: Simplify _SMP_Multicast_action()
Move resposibility to disable …
5
|
|
|
@65870044
|
04/18/19 04:47:01 |
Sebastian Huber |
score: Add _SMP_Broadcast_action()
5
|
|
|
@9f52acb5
|
04/17/19 09:05:26 |
Sebastian Huber |
smptests: Move SMP broadcast action test case
5
|
|
|
@317997f
|
04/20/19 08:09:43 |
Sebastian Huber |
smpmulticast01: Use T_TEST_CASE()
5
|
|
|
@ef9d20f6
|
04/12/19 09:13:32 |
Sebastian Huber |
score: More robust _SMP_Multicast_action()
If the caller already …
5
|
|
|
@f410b31b
|
04/11/19 13:39:36 |
Sebastian Huber |
score: Improve _SMP_Multicast_action()
Let it work during system …
5
|
|
|
@e90486a
|
04/11/19 13:16:40 |
Sebastian Huber |
score: Rework SMP multicast action
Use a FIFO list of jobs per …
5
|
|
|
@df8d7bd7
|
04/09/19 08:58:35 |
Sebastian Huber |
score: Use processor mask in _SMP_Multicast_action
Processor_mask is …
5
|
|
|
@f9219db
|
04/05/19 06:16:05 |
Sebastian Huber |
rtems: Add rtems_scheduler_get_processor_maximum()
Add …
5
|
|
|
@03c9f24
|
04/05/19 06:03:12 |
Sebastian Huber |
rtems: Add rtems_scheduler_get_processor()
Add …
5
|
|
|
@fbd08066
|
02/07/19 06:46:38 |
Sebastian Huber |
score: Fix plain priority thread queues (SMP)
We must add/remove the …
5
|
|
|
@b015c01
|
01/28/19 11:26:25 |
Sebastian Huber |
build: Do not install test programs
5
|
|
|
@1f285186
|
01/08/19 07:39:42 |
Sebastian Huber |
rtems: Allow to set ISR level 0 in SMP config
Update #3000.
5
|
|
|
@7c19e50
|
12/18/18 07:45:06 |
Sebastian Huber |
score: Fix per-CPU data allocation
Allocate the per-CPU data for …
5
|
|
|
@0446f680
|
12/03/18 20:37:32 |
mcomajoancara |
Spelling and grammar fixes in source code comments (GCI 2018)
5
|
|
|
@0a75a4aa
|
11/26/18 13:04:59 |
Sebastian Huber |
Remove rtems_cache_*_processor_set() functions
The following …
5
|
|
|
@24f3e8f
|
10/25/18 12:02:23 |
Sebastian Huber |
posix: Enable more smptests tests by default
Update #2514.
5
|
|
|
@477bca2
|
10/06/18 08:59:10 |
Sebastian Huber |
build: Remove local.am
5
|
|
|
@51b3cbca
|
10/04/18 13:23:25 |
Sebastian Huber |
tests: Use rtems_task_exit()
Update #3533.
5
|
|
|
@8776bb9
|
09/26/18 04:34:54 |
Sebastian Huber |
score: Remove CPU_PROVIDES_IDLE_THREAD_BODY
Remove the …
5
|
|
|
@431661d
|
09/19/18 12:12:59 |
Daniel Hellstrom |
smp03: make printout match actual task name
5
|
|
|
@7097962
|
08/29/18 07:43:44 |
Sebastian Huber |
score: Add thread pin/unpin support
Add support to temporarily pin a …
5
|
|
|
@e0a9336b
|
09/03/18 06:12:35 |
Sebastian Huber |
score: Fix EDF SMP scheduler
Fix a special case: block a one-to-one …
5
|
|
|
@4678d1a
|
07/24/18 08:50:39 |
Sebastian Huber |
bsps: bsp_start_on_secondary_processor()
Pass current processor …
5
|
|
|
@91f39a5
|
07/24/18 09:56:25 |
Sebastian Huber |
smptests: Fix format warnings
5
|
|
|
@ffd4617
|
07/17/18 13:33:49 |
Sebastian Huber |
score: Fix _Scheduler_EDF_SMP_Set_affinity()
Commit …
5
|
|
|
@2086948a
|
05/11/18 04:54:59 |
Sebastian Huber |
riscv: Add dummy SMP support
Update #3433.
5
|
|
|
@b422aa3f
|
04/26/18 14:05:45 |
Sebastian Huber |
tests: Remove configure feature checks
Update #3409.
5
|
|
|
@8b5a801
|
04/27/18 05:20:27 |
Sebastian Huber |
smptests/smpschededf02: Add test case
5
|
|
|
@5e8a24ca
|
04/23/18 08:35:35 |
Sebastian Huber |
smptests/smpschedaffinity02: Fix configuration
5
|
|
|
@aa567bc1
|
04/10/18 06:06:39 |
Chris Johns |
configure: Add subdir-objects to all automake flags.
This option …
5
|
|
|
@8074fa0b
|
04/09/18 03:44:37 |
Chris Johns |
testsuite/smptests: Merged nested Makefile.am files into one …
5
|
|
|
@6fadb7af
|
03/08/18 05:33:24 |
Sebastian Huber |
config: Use new scheduler configuration defines
Update #3325.
5
|
|
|
@ff281a6f
|
03/07/18 09:31:10 |
Sebastian Huber |
smptests: Fix obsolete FIXME comments/code
5
|
|
|
@0c5d22f
|
12/18/17 09:24:34 |
Sebastian Huber |
smptests/smpopenmp01: New test
5
|
|
|
@cf56b18a
|
02/02/18 06:48:08 |
Sebastian Huber |
smpschededf01: Use rtems_test_busy_cpu_usage()
The rtems_test_busy() …
5
|
|
|
@63fab5aa
|
02/01/18 14:14:55 |
Sebastian Huber |
smpschedaffinity04: Fix configuration
5
|
|
|
@c9aba80
|
02/01/18 14:11:41 |
Sebastian Huber |
smpcapture01: Fix configuration
5
|
|
|
@2afb22b
|
12/23/17 07:18:56 |
Chris Johns |
Remove make preinstall
A speciality of the RTEMS build system was the …
5
|
|
|
@6bc5e47
|
12/22/17 12:44:56 |
Sebastian Huber |
smptests: Fix configuration
Update #2843.
5
|
|
|
@cf2024b
|
01/19/18 12:08:46 |
Sebastian Huber |
smp03: Use floating-point tasks
This test uses sprintf().
5
|
|
|
@cf099be
|
01/19/18 12:04:25 |
Sebastian Huber |
smp03: Use floating-point task
This test uses sprintf().
5
|
|
|
@5e3ef46
|
01/19/18 09:57:38 |
Sebastian Huber |
smpaffinity01: Use floating-point task
This test uses sprintf().
5
|
|
|
@7274e67
|
01/19/18 09:56:13 |
Sebastian Huber |
smp08: Use floating-point task
This test uses sprintf().
5
|
|
|
@e6d89860
|
01/19/18 08:52:23 |
Sebastian Huber |
smpmigration01: Enable floating-point output
5
|
|
|
@e9e0f1d4
|
12/05/17 15:56:47 |
joel |
smpunsupported01: Add missing error check for rtems_task_mode
Update …
5
|
|
|
@c597fb1
|
11/09/17 15:21:37 |
Sebastian Huber |
score: Optimize scheduler priority updates
Thread priority changes …
5
|
|
|
@ec771f2
|
11/16/17 14:04:21 |
Sebastian Huber |
score: Fix priority ceiling updates
We must not clear the priority …
5
|
|
|
@9c30c31e
|
11/16/17 13:38:07 |
Sebastian Huber |
score: Fix _Thread_queue_Flush_critical()
The thread queue extract …
5
|
|
|
@7b00c2fa
|
11/06/17 06:56:17 |
Sebastian Huber |
tests: Use <tmacros.h> in all tests
Update #3170.
Update #3199.
5
|
|
|
@c4b8b147
|
11/03/17 07:35:38 |
Sebastian Huber |
tests: Use simple console driver
Update #3170.
Update #3199.
5
|
|
|
@a54d10d
|
11/03/17 11:53:51 |
Sebastian Huber |
smpscheduler02: Avoid sporadic test failures
5
|
|
|
@0d796d6
|
11/02/17 13:08:02 |
Sebastian Huber |
tests: Delete obsolete TESTS_USE_PRINTF
Update #3170.
Update #3199.
5
|
|
|
@81fd79d
|
10/27/17 06:52:41 |
Sebastian Huber |
smppsxaffinity02: Fix thread attribute usage
The pthread_getattr_np() …
5
|
|
|
@af43554
|
10/26/17 11:59:11 |
Sebastian Huber |
tests: Remove TEST_INIT
The TEST_EXTERN is a used only by the …
5
|
|
|
@acc9d064
|
10/26/17 11:59:10 |
Sebastian Huber |
tests: Remove obsolete TESTS_USE_PRINTK
Update #3170.
Update #3199.
5
|
|
|
@73d892d8
|
10/26/17 11:59:07 |
Sebastian Huber |
tests: Use rtems_test_printer
Update #3170.
Update #3199.
5
|
|
|
@0f1fa19
|
10/26/17 11:19:57 |
Sebastian Huber |
smptests: Fix format warnings
5
|
|
|
@e3ef14b
|
10/25/17 05:57:58 |
Sebastian Huber |
smptests: Remove duplicate Makefile targets
Close #3187.
5
|
|
|
@88e84c22
|
10/23/17 11:48:56 |
Sebastian Huber |
testsuite: Fix build
Updates #3170.
5
|
|
|
@98c6d50
|
10/19/17 05:39:16 |
Chris Johns |
testsuite: Use printk for all test output where possible.
- Remove …
5
|
|
|
@16aaf73b
|
10/11/17 06:33:19 |
Sebastian Huber |
smpaffinity01: Fix test case
Update #2514.
5
|
|
|
@a3ad4af
|
10/10/17 09:22:21 |
Sebastian Huber |
posix: Validate affinity sets by the scheduler
Update #2514.
5
|
|
|
@af9115f3
|
10/06/17 08:07:38 |
Sebastian Huber |
posix: Simplify POSIX_API_Control
Return stack area via …
5
|
|
|
@de59c065
|
09/27/17 13:08:33 |
Sebastian Huber |
posix: Implement self-contained POSIX mutex
POSIX mutexes are now …
5
|
|
|
@02b007e
|
08/25/17 12:39:38 |
Sebastian Huber |
Include missing <limits.h>
Update #2132.
5
|
|
|
@a8f4fd2
|
08/10/17 12:29:55 |
Sebastian Huber |
smptests: Fix format specifier
Update #3082.
5
|
|
|
@96ce1ec
|
07/19/17 11:03:13 |
Sebastian Huber |
smptests/smpscheduler02: Remove invalid assert
Update #3059.
5
|
|
|
@7ad8239
|
07/19/17 10:58:55 |
Sebastian Huber |
smptests/smpscheduler01: Use right scheduler
Update #3063.
5
|
|
|
@6f46848
|
07/19/17 09:57:01 |
Sebastian Huber |
tests: Use floating point task
These tests directly or indirectly use …
5
|
|
|
@07e1780
|
07/18/17 11:07:26 |
Sebastian Huber |
tests: Use floating point task
These tests directly or indirectly use …
5
|
|
|
@ecabd384
|
07/11/17 07:51:43 |
Sebastian Huber |
rtems: Add rtems_scheduler_ident_by_processor_set
Update #3070.
5
|
|
|
@548d65a5
|
07/11/17 05:24:39 |
Sebastian Huber |
rtems: Add rtems_scheduler_ident_by_processor()
Update #3069.
5
|
|
|
@4a1bdd30
|
07/07/17 06:30:20 |
Sebastian Huber |
score: Fix set scheduler
Ensure that the thread processor affinity …
5
|
|
|
@34487537
|
07/04/17 07:57:30 |
Sebastian Huber |
score: Add simple affinity support to EDF SMP
Update #3059.
5
|
|
|
@e745ec5
|
07/04/17 07:48:52 |
Sebastian Huber |
smptests/smpstrongapa01: Simplify
Update #3059.
5
|
|
|
@16347a6
|
07/07/17 05:36:52 |
Sebastian Huber |
score: Fix default set affinity
The set of online processors must be …
5
|
|
|
@76d1198
|
07/07/17 05:45:57 |
Sebastian Huber |
score: Introduce _SMP_Get_online_processors()
Update #3059.
5
|
|
|
@0232b28
|
07/04/17 06:59:37 |
Sebastian Huber |
score: Use processor mask for set affinity
Update #3059.
5
|
|
|
@7851555
|
07/03/17 12:05:26 |
Sebastian Huber |
score: Move processor affinity to Thread_Control
Update #3059.
5
|
|
|
@3dfe55ee
|
07/03/17 09:46:12 |
Sebastian Huber |
score: Use <sys/bitset.h> for Processor_mask
Implement the …
5
|
|
|
@7adf4941
|
06/29/17 13:21:30 |
Sebastian Huber |
smptests/smpschededf01: New test
Update #3056.
5
|
|
|
@f3d9f228
|
06/26/17 08:35:45 |
Sebastian Huber |
score: Add SMP EDF scheduler
Update #3056.
5
|
|
|
@1dbce41
|
06/26/17 08:27:23 |
Sebastian Huber |
smptests: Split smpscheduler03
Split smpscheduler03 to run the tests …
5
|
|
|
@836f454
|
06/07/17 06:14:30 |
Sebastian Huber |
Fix CPU_COPY() usage
The original CPU_COPY() support of Newlib …
5
|
|
|
@9b91c84
|
04/05/17 09:29:02 |
Sebastian Huber |
smpcache01: Fix test to run on QorIQ T4240
5
|
|
|
@258bda3
|
04/03/17 22:11:24 |
Chris Johns |
testsuite: Add a common test configuration. Fix configure.ac and …
5
|
|
|
@54835ae
|
02/01/17 13:10:18 |
Sebastian Huber |
Rename CONFIGURE_SMP_MAXIMUM_PROCESSORS
Rename …
5
|
|
|
@239dd35f
|
02/03/17 10:24:30 |
Sebastian Huber |
smptests: Fix warnings
5
|
|
|
@ca1e546e
|
02/02/17 15:24:05 |
Sebastian Huber |
score: Improve scheduler helping protocol
Only register ask for help …
5
|
|
|